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

NetherlandsThe only comment is that the kitchen lacked some equipment. A tray, a couple of serving platters and a large chopping board would have been very useful.
Location was great right by a lovely big beach with some beach bars. The hotel itself is really beautifully landscaped - super green with five pools with a lot of loungers and a choice of restaurants. We ate at the buffet several times as the choice was extensive so it was easy for everyone to have what they wanted. We had a luxury two bedroom apartment which was very spacious with beautiful views, super quiet at night and a lot of privacy on the terrace. We used the spa area one afternoon and it is very well equipped and spacious.

SwitzerlandThe water in the pools was rather cold. There was no pool for younger kids / babies. We were very happy on the beach, but I can imagine that some may miss that. Kitchen was decently equipped. Although it didn’t have a kettle or a large chopping board. There was no small shop on site for water, etc. So if you don’t have a car, the walk to the next shopt is a bit of a stretch
The 2 bedroom apartment was spacious and had a good layout. Very clean and bright. Ours was on the ground floor, perfect for us with a 3yr old. The gardens are truly lovely and provide a lot of privacy. Two pools are fenced in, so kids can run around without being worried about falling in. Breakfast buffet was great and varied, something for everyone. Did the buffet dinner 3x too, always different. Always delicious. The beach is fabulous, can’t rave enough. Spa treatments very good too.
